Transaction 148d7a45800a7252f93900a85ebfa25d7e5221ce97c73460c59452d8da46ef9a
1 Input
1 Output
-
148d7a45800a7252f93900a85ebfa25d7e5221ce97c73460c59452d8da46ef9a:0
- value
- 262220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95faba97fc53a4bcd62d8238421ea43105716b63 OP_EQUAL
- address
- 3FN2y5HBDoi2Uv18945J4nNGX6SRWa9faw